Steps to Take Immediately After a Pedestrian Accident in El Cajon
The moments following a pedestrian accident are confusing and stressful, but taking the correct steps helps protect both your health and your legal claim.
Seek Immediate Medical Attention
Your health should always be the first priority. Even if injuries appear minor, internal injuries, concussions, or soft tissue damage may not show symptoms right away. Prompt medical evaluation creates documentation that directly connects your injuries to the accident.
Call Law Enforcement
A police report provides an official record of the accident and may include important details about fault, witness statements, and road conditions. This documentation often becomes an essential part of a pedestrian injury claim.
Document the Scene
If you are able, take photographs of the accident scene, vehicle damage, traffic signals, crosswalk markings, and visible injuries. These details help establish how the accident occurred.
Collect Witness Information
Independent witnesses can play a significant role in supporting your claim, especially if liability becomes disputed later.
Avoid Speaking to Insurance Adjusters Without Legal Guidance
Insurance companies often contact injured pedestrians quickly. Providing recorded statements without legal advice can unintentionally harm your case. Consulting a pedestrian accident injury lawyer in El Cajon before speaking with insurers helps protect your interests.
Common Causes of Pedestrian Accidents in El Cajon
Most pedestrian accidents are preventable and occur because drivers fail to operate vehicles safely. Common causes include:
- Distracted driving, including texting or phone use
- Failure to yield at crosswalks
- Speeding in residential or commercial areas
- Unsafe turns at intersections
- Dri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s
- Failure to observe pedestrians in low-visibility conditions
Determining the cause of the accident is a key part of establishing liability and building a strong legal claim.
Common Injuries in Pedestrian Accident Cases
Because pedestrians lack physical protection, injuries are often severe and require extensive medical treatment. These injuries may include:
- Traumatic brain injuries and concussions
- Spinal cord injuries and paralysis
- Broken bones and fractures
- Internal organ injuries
- Soft tissue injuries and chronic pain
- Emotional trauma and post-traumatic stress
Some injuries result in long-term or permanent disabilities, making it essential to consider future medical care and life impacts when pursuing compensation.
Understanding California Pedestrian Laws
California law generally requires drivers to yield the right of way to pedestrians in marked and unmarked crosswalks. Despite this, insurance companies frequently attempt to argue that pedestrians were partially responsible for accidents. They may claim the pedestrian crossed improperly or was not paying attention.
California follows a comparative negligence system, meaning compensation may be reduced if a pedestrian is found partially at fault. This makes strong legal representation especially important in pedestrian accident cases.
Statute of Limitations for Pedestrian Accident Claims
In most pedestrian accident cases in California, injured individuals have two years from the date of the accident to file a personal injury lawsuit. Missing this deadline typically results in losing the right to pursue compensation. How Insurance Companies Manipulate Pedestrian Accident Claims
Insurance companies are businesses focused on limiting payouts. They often use strategies designed to reduce or deny legitimate claims.
Shifting Blame
Insurers may argue that the pedestrian caused or contributed to the accident in order to reduce liability.
Minimizing Injuries
Adjusters may claim injuries are less serious than medical records indicate or unrelated to the accident.
Quick Settlement Offers
Early offers are often far below the actual value of a claim and may not account for future treatment or long-term consequences.
Delays and Pressure
Delaying communication or payments can create financial stress that pressures victims into accepting inadequate settlements.
